Making Connections 
We would love the opportunity to connect with your school program. This could be a visit from myself to talk about programs and admissions, a visit from a studio instructor to work with your band or choir, or from students to share their experiences.

We have people in our Popular Music Studies area who would love to connect with you to talk about songwriting and recording. These connections can be in person or virtual.  

Professor Jana Starling is offering mentorship opportunities (free of charge) for clarinet students. You can download the poster with all the details.

We will be offering a similar mentorship opportunity for French Horn students, who are welcome to attend our Monday masterclasses and stick around to join us for some ensemble playing. We can connect them with our French Horn students for lessons.

Our trumpet professor Aaron Hodgson and our new trombone professor Denis Jiron are travelling to schools to do clinics on Monday mornings. If you would like for them to make a stop at your school, please reach out to me.

Brass Day 
Our Brass Day is back this fall! The date is Saturday November 12 and includes concerts, clinics a vendor room, and is open to brass enthusiasts of all ages. This year's event will feature Karen Donnelly, principal trumpet of the National Arts Centre Orchestra in Ottawa. 

Vocal Intensive Program 
Western University's Don Wright Faculty of Music presents a 3-Day Vocal Intensive for High School Singers November 18-20 featuring tours, private lessons, masterclasses, a choral workshop, class auditing, meeting current voice students and participating in a Q&A, an opera ticket for Hansel and Gretel and much more!

High School Competition continues
Last year’s High School Competition saw a lot of interest, and it will continue this year with a new category added in composition. We would like to invite current high school students to participate in a competition for performers and songwriters. This will be an online competition and six prizes of $400 will be available (no strings attached). You can learn more about the competition on our website. Deadline for students to apply is December 15, 2022.
